The newly upgraded field at Marist Brothers High School will see more upgrades in the next few months.
This was after a Memorandum of Understanding was signed between the school and Guangzhou Construction Group who will construct an up to standard triple jump rubber track.

Director-General of Guangzhou Foreign Affairs Office, Liu Baochun says the amenities would help teachers and students develop physical fitness and extra curricular activities as well as creating a dynamic school environment.
He says the two countries had established a strategic partnership for joint development in 2014 and this project is a positive contribution in promoting the friendship between China and Fiji.
Minister for Education Rosy Akbar says this ceremony is a testament of the genuine and deep relationship Fiji and China has had for a long period of time.

She stressed these projects will boost the participation of students and teachers in physical activities and also contribute to the fight against non-communicable disease.
